About the position:

This position is Non-appropriated Fund (NAF) and is located at the Auto Hobby Shop, Spangdahlem AB, Germany.

This is a flexible position, 0-40 hours per week. You may be required to work days, nights, weekends, and holidays.

Must be able to lift objects weighing up to 40 pounds. Must be able to frequently bend, reach, and work in awkward positions.

Military Spouse Preference is not lost if selected for this position.

The Area of Consideration for this vacancy announcement is US Citizens and legal US residents in Germany. Recruitment limited only to the local commuting area of Spangdahlem.

Legal U.S. residents must possess a social security number or green card and must be:

  • A US citizen,
  • A citizen of NATO country, other than the host country (Germany).

In accordance with the NATO Status of Forces Agreement with Germany, citizens of the host country and non-NATO countries are not eligible for US NAF Employment.

These individuals may be eligible for employment under the Local National (LN) program; you may contact the LN Team at 06565-61-6080 or DSN 452-6080 for more information on eligibility requirements. Must be able to provide documentation proving residence status overseas.

In order to qualify, you must meet the experience requirements described below. Experience refers to paid and unpaid experience, including volunteer work done through National Service programs (e.g., Peace Corps, AmeriCorps) and other organizations (e.g., professional; philanthropic; religious; spiritual; community; student; social). You will receive credit for all qualifying experience, including volunteer experience. Your resume must clearly describe your relevant experience; if qualifying based on education, your transcripts will be required as part of your application.

Qualifying Experience:
  • Must have experience servicing vehicles (i.e., lubricate, oil and filter change).
  • Must be able to read and understand manual specifications and be able to verbally communicate with patrons.
  • Successful completion of technical/vocational school training in an automotive servicing course in which applicant gained a basic knowledge of automotive servicing may be substituted for the required experience.
  • Must be physically able to lift objects weighing up to 40 pounds.
  • Must be able to frequently bend, reach, and work in awkward positions.
